It's been at least, ooh, three days since I came out with a controversial opinion. So, anyone else think that Smash Run is... a bit off? While I love running around the maze and taking on the enemies, the fact that it all builds up to what is frequently a one-minute battle, for which the settings can't be changed, is a massive anticlimax. Would have been better to keep it just as a score attack.

And while I love that you get Cryogonals, Streetpass ghosts, and the Rhythm Tengoku ghosts in there, Sakurai has definitely shown some favouritism in the enemy mix. So many KIU foes. Monoeyes, Reapers, Souffles, the green ghosts with claws, the white ghosts with claws, the flower things, Clubberskulls, Bumpety Bombs, the rock pillars with tiny legs, and I swear I saw an Orne once... Too many, Sakurai, too many!

So, I have played quite a bit over the past few days and I really like the gameplay. I have done a few online matches and all were close to unplayable which is a shame. Still, local mode is a blast and the cpu at level 9 offer a decent challenge.

As for game modes... kind of average, classic is nice and simple, all star offers a good challenge. Smash Run is weird but I can see it being fun with human players.

The roster is good but I cant help but feel that Charizard, Lucario and Greninja are all underwhelming. I have to say that Pikachu and Jigg are the superior pokemon fighters which I would never have expected before playing.

From a competitive point of view im tipping Pit to do well, two attacks that reflect projectiles (that side special... wow) and a side smash that has more range and power than it appears. Zero suit, Pac-Man also look really good.
